Corey Dennard Aka “Mr. Hanky”
Musical Roots & Career Evolution
Born Corey Dennard and raised in East Atlanta, he developed his musical talents early, playing trumpet and piano before earning a scholarship to Southern University, where he performed in the Human Jukebox Marching Band. His production career began in college, selling beats out of his dorm room before securing a role as an in-house producer at Collipark Music.
In 2006, he launched Mr. Hanky Productions, producing standout hits like “Throwed Off” (Treal Lee & Prince Rick) and “Smart Girl Dumb Booty” (Tex James ft. Stuey Rock). His track “California” was featured in the movie Keanu and multiple major films, solidifying his influence beyond music.
In 2018 he launched Cultural Resources LLC. a full service production and entertainment company which became the home for all of his production and artist.
In 2021 he co founded Klean Energy Kulture a non profit catered to environmental justice to underserved communities. Projects like “Electrify The City” which revitalizes prominent staples in the community through energy efficiency audits, and workforce development have taken the organization to new heights. So much that the City of Atlanta’s Office of Sustainability has partnered with the organization for its upcoming projects.
